#include "app_config.h"
#include "system/includes.h"
#include "app_msg.h"
#include "app_mode.h"
#include "app_main.h"
#include "key_driver.h"
#include "ui_key_remap.h"
#include "ui_api.h"
#include "jlui_app/ui_style.h"
#define LOG_TAG_CONST UI
#define LOG_TAG "[UI_KEY]"
#define LOG_ERROR_ENABLE
#define LOG_DEBUG_ENABLE
#define LOG_INFO_ENABLE
#define LOG_CLI_ENABLE
#include "debug.h"
/***********************************************************************************
JL框架
***********************************************************************************/
#if (defined(CONFIG_UI_STYLE_JL_PUBLIC_MODLS_ENABLE)) ||(defined(CONFIG_UI_STYLE_JL_CSC_PUBLIC_MODLS_ENABLE))
struct ui_key_remap_handler {
void (*send_event_cb)(int key_event);
};
struct ui_jlui_key_remap_table {
u8 key_value;
const int *remap_table;
};
static struct ui_key_remap_handler hdl;
#define __this (&hdl)
/*lvgl只需要down up事件*/
#ifdef CONFIG_UI_STYLE_JL_CSC_PUBLIC_MODLS_ENABLE
#define JLUI_KEY_EVENT_MAX 4
#else
#define JLUI_KEY_EVENT_MAX 3
#endif
#define JLUI_KEY_EVENT_TABLE_MAX 6
static const int key_io_num0_event_table[JLUI_KEY_EVENT_MAX] = {
KEY_UI_HOME, KEY_UI_POWEROFF, KEY_UI_MENU_LIST,
};
static const int key_ad_num0_event_table[JLUI_KEY_EVENT_MAX] = {
#ifdef CONFIG_UI_STYLE_JL_CSC_PUBLIC_MODLS_ENABLE
KEY_UI_HOME, KEY_UI_POWEROFF, KEY_UI_MENU_LIST, KEY_UI_TRIPLE_CLICK,
#else
KEY_UI_HOME, KEY_UI_POWEROFF, KEY_UI_MENU_LIST,
#endif
};
static const int key_ad_num1_event_table[JLUI_KEY_EVENT_MAX] = {
KEY_UI_SHORTCUT,
};
const struct ui_jlui_key_remap_table jlui_key_watch_event_table[JLUI_KEY_EVENT_TABLE_MAX ] = {
{ .key_value = KEY_IO_NUM0, .remap_table = key_io_num0_event_table },
{ .key_value = KEY_AD_NUM0, .remap_table = key_ad_num0_event_table },
{ .key_value = KEY_AD_NUM1, .remap_table = key_ad_num1_event_table },
{ .key_value = 0xff }
};
/*将key_event进行映射成具体的按键事件*/
u16 jlui_key_event_remap(struct key_event *key, const struct ui_jlui_key_remap_table *table)
{
u16 key_event = -1;
int key_value;
if (key->event == KEY_ACTION_RDEC_ROTATE) { // 旋转编码器
key_value = key->value;
if (key_value > 0) {
key_event = KEY_UI_PLUS; // 正转
} else if (key_value < 0) {
key_event = KEY_UI_MINUS; // 反转
}
return key_event;
}
for (int i = 0; table[i].key_value != 0xff; i++) {
if (jlui_key_watch_event_table[i].key_value == key->value) {
if (table[i].remap_table) {
if (key->event == KEY_ACTION_CLICK) {
key_event = table[i].remap_table[0];
} else if (key->event == KEY_ACTION_HOLD) {
key_event = table[i].remap_table[1];
} else if (key->event == KEY_ACTION_DOUBLE_CLICK) {
key_event = table[i].remap_table[2];
} else if (key->event == KEY_ACTION_TRIPLE_CLICK) {
key_event = table[i].remap_table[3];
} else {
key_event = KEY_WATCH_NO_KEY;
}
}
break;
}
}
return key_event;
}
void ui_key_set_send_event_cb(void (*cb)(int key_event))
{
if (cb) {
__this->send_event_cb = cb;
}
}
static int ui_key_event_prob_handle(void *arg)
{
struct key_event *key = (struct key_event *)arg;
u16 key_event;
log_debug("[%s] key->event:%d, key->value:%d", __func__, key->event, key->value);
if (app_get_current_mode_name() == APP_MODE_UPDATE ||
app_get_current_mode_name() == APP_MODE_RCSP) {
log_info("%s return", __func__);
return 0; // 传输的时候不处理
}
key_event = jlui_key_event_remap(key, jlui_key_watch_event_table);
if (__this->send_event_cb) {
__this->send_event_cb(key_event);
return 1; /*接管事件*/
}
return 0; /*不接管事件*/
}
/*拦截key_driver产生的key_event*/
REGISTER_KEY_DET_CALLBACK(jlui_key) = {
.name = NULL,
.arg = NULL,
.cb_deal = ui_key_event_prob_handle,
};
#endif
